    Comments Thread For: Pascal's Take: Hopkins-Dawson Will Be a Boring Fight

    Former WBC/IBO light heavyweight champion Jean Pascal (26-2, 16KOs) is not expecting fireworks in the upcoming championship fight between Bernard Hopkins (52-5-2, 32KOs) and Chad Dawson (30-1, 17KOs), which takes place on October 15 at Staples Center in Los Angeles, California. Pascal won an eleven round technical decision over Dawson last August. He fought Hopkins to a controversial draw in December and lost a close decision in their May rematch.
